Top Efficiency Enhancements for Velocity and Strength
Maximizing velocity and force in a vehicle often starts with a assortment of key performance upgrades. One of the most potent upgrades is the installation of a high-performance air intake system, which enhances airflow to the engine, improving combustion efficiency. Coupled with this, a sport exhaust system can greatly reduce back pressure, promoting better engine breathing and increased horsepower.
Adding a essential performance chip or tuner is another vital improvement, as it adjusts the engine's computer to enhance fuel delivery and ignition timing. The upgrade to a high-performance fuel pump ensures that the engine receives enough fuel to meet the increased demands of other modifications. Lastly, replacing the stock turbocharger for a more powerful and better performing unit can offer substantial gains in speed and power, making it a well-liked choice among enthusiasts. Collectively, these upgrades can elevate a standard vehicle into a performance-oriented machine.
Refining Responsiveness: Best Chassis Modifications
How can a car's performance be markedly enhanced? Enhancing suspension parts is crucial for attaining superior performance. To begin with, aftermarket coilovers offer adjustable ride height and damping, allowing drivers to fine-tune their car's responsiveness and balance. Furthermore, stabilizer bars, or anti-roll bars, reduce vehicle lean during turning, enhancing better grip and control.
In addition, structural braces strengthen chassis structural strength, curtailing flex and advancing overall responsive control. Another practical upgrade is the setup of performance shocks, which ensure superior shock management and control over assorted road conditions.
Lastly, upgrading bushings to high-performance materials can minimize unwanted movement and improve feedback from the road. By applying these suspension modifications, drivers can experience a significant improvement in handling, resulting in a more engaging and confident driving experience. Modern Alloy Wheels
Alloy wheels are a notable upgrade for automotive fans looking to boost both performance and aesthetic. These wheels are usually lighter than their steel counterparts, which can enhance handling and acceleration. Available in a range of designs, finishes, and sizes, alloy wheels allow owners to adapt their vehicles to reflect personal style while also optimizing functionality. Many options offer intricate patterns and vibrant colors, providing a sleek, modern look that can boost any ride. In addition, alloy wheels often include advanced engineering techniques that enhance durability and resistance to corrosion. This combination of style and performance renders them a popular choice among car enthusiasts wanting to customize their vehicles effectively. DIY vs. Professional: Which Setup Is Right for You?
Weighing DIY installation against qualified assistance can greatly influence both the result and the overall experience of upgrading high-performance auto parts. DIY practitioners often find reward in hands-on work, potentially economizing while gaining valuable skills. However, this choice requires a solid understanding of car systems, implements, and techniques. Errors can result in costly damages or safety issues.
Conversely, professional installation delivers expertise and assurance. Certified technicians can guarantee that parts are correctly installed, optimizing performance and longevity. This path typically comes with a warranty, providing peace of mind.
At the end of the day, the selection is based on individual skill levels, budget considerations, and the scope of the project. For those assured in their abilities and equipped with relevant information the right tools, DIY may be gratifying. Conversely, for those unsure or contending with intricate upgrades, seeking professional assistance is often the safer and more impactful option.

Does Installing Premium Parts Void My Vehicle's Warranty?
High-performance parts may potentially void a vehicle's warranty, particularly if the modifications directly cause damage. However, many manufacturers permit certain upgrades. It's wise to speak with the warranty terms or a dealer for clarification.

Do Power Enhancements Comply with My State's Laws?
Performance upgrades are limited by local standards, which fluctuate by state. It is essential for vehicle owners to research specific laws and guidelines to ensure compliance and prevent potential legal troubles regarding modifications.
What Constitutes the Average Cost of High-Performance Upgrades?
The typical price of high-performance upgrades typically ranges from $500 to $5,000, depending on the vehicle type and specific modifications. Installation fees and additional parts can additionally affect the total cost for enthusiasts.
